Function of jugular veins
The function of the internal jugular vein is to collect blood from the skull, brain, superficial parts of the face, and the majority of the neck. The tributaries of the internal jugular include the inferior petrosal sinus, facial, lingual, pharyngeal, superior and middle thyroid, and, occasionally, the occipital vein.

What is secondary succession?When a disturbance does not completely remove all life and nutrients from the environment, secondary succession occurs.
Despite the fact that fire, flooding, and other disturbances can devastate a landscape, drive away many plants and animals, and reset the biological community to an earlier stage, the habitat remains alive because the soil stores nutrients and seeds that were laid down before to the disturbance.
Buried seeds can sprout soon after the disruption has passed, and some may have a better chance because of less competition and less shading. Some animals may have evolved to deal with a particular disturbance on a regular basis.

What are Vascular tissues?Vascular tissues in plants are specialised tissues which transport nutrients and water through the plant. They are made up of two distinct kinds of tissues: xylem and phloem.
Xylem is in charge of carrying water and minerals that are dissolved from the plant's roots to its leaves. It is made up of many cell types, such as tracheids, vessel components, and fibres. Tracheids and vessel elements are long, hollow structures that create lengthy tubes when stacked end to end.
Sugars and other organic compounds are transported from the leaves to the remainder of the plant by phloem. There are two sorts of cells in it: sieve tube elements and cell companions. Sieve tube components are long, narrow cells that run end to end.

A student carried out an experiment to model the digestion of starch by the enzyme amylase in the small intestine.
Visking tubing is a selectively permeable membrane that has small holes in it to allow small molecules to pass through. At regular intervals, the student tested the liquid inside and outside the Visking tube.
How could the student test for the presence of starch inside the Visking tubing?
Answer:
Put one drop on the dimple tile, and the rest in a test tube. Then put the teat pipette back in the water outside the Visking tubing. Test the drops of liquid in the dimple tile by adding one drop of iodine solution from the dropper bottle. If they turn blue-black, the liquid contains starch.
